Detailed Solution

The revolt of 1857 began in Meerut. Mangal Pandey was executed on April 8, 1857, for assaulting his officers in Barrackpore. A few days later, some sepoys from the regiment at Meerut objected to using the new cartridges in the army drill since they were thought to be covered in pig and cow fat. The other Indian soldiers at Meerut responded in a most unusual way. The army marched to the Meerut jail on May 10 and freed the sepoys who were being held there. British officers were attacked and killed by them. They took British weapons and ammunition, destroyed British structures and property, and launched a war on the British. The sepoys from Meerut rode all through the night of May 10 in order to arrive in Delhi the next morning. The troops stationed in Delhi also revolted as word of their arrival spread.
